How do i connect an diod/led (power on indicator) on front panel?

I will use a power on switch on the backpanel but want something that tells me the amplifier is turned on on the front.

There are some power on switches with led indicators built in to buy but i would prefer a smaller one.

There is a aux power out, it is 21v when on 220voltage and 42v on 110voltage
Connector J1 on the SMPS power supply. i think that would be the way to go to hook up a led

I used a fibre optical (toslink) cable to get the light from the LEDs of the amps to the front panel. All you have to do is take the plastic cases of the toslink cable. there is a little metallic connector with a lens under the plastic plug which fits nicely into the front panel through a 2.5 mm hole

removal of the plastic protection



one end over the LED on the amp



With this cable, I could use the outer insulation to fit the cable over the LED



the other end has the light. You can drill a 2.5mm hole through the front panel. The light is discreet but very visible
